== CVL849 : Traffic Flow Modelling ==&lt;br /&gt;
Descriptors of traffic flow: Macroscopic and Microscopic, time, space and generalized measurement regions. Cumulative plots. Traffic Flow models - General classification and typology. Macroscopic Flow Models - continuity equation, LWR model, higher order models, numerical schema, Mesoscopic Flow Models - gas kinetic theory, Microscopic and Submicroscopic Flow Models - car following and lane changing; Pipes and forbes models; General motors-Gazis-Herman-Rothery (GHR) models, Stability analysis, macro-micro bridge. Modelling at Junctions/Intersections; Un-signalized and Signalized; Roundabouts; Pedestrian Modelling - normal and panic movements; variations across infrastructure; Simulation - simple and complex traffic conditions.&lt;/div&gt;</summary>
